Lead Technical Application Service Specialist

Locations: Edinburgh & Bristol

Hours: Full Time – 35 Hours per week

Working Pattern: Our work style is hybrid, which involves spending at least two days per week, or 40% of our time, at one of our office sites

Salary Range: £83,411 - £107,943

About this Opportunity

As a Lead Technical Application Specialist, you'll help deliver great customer experiences, shape high performing teams and drive engineering excellence. You'll have the opportunity to shape either our legacy systems or digital services, with two dynamic roles available to make a lasting impact. This position takes a leading role in enabling the Group's ambition to modernise our digital capabilities whilst serving our current digital demand.

You'll continuously challenge, motivate, mentor, and support your teams, encouraging a culture of innovation and excellence. Your deep technical expertise will enable you to work within or lead cross-disciplinary teams, resolving service-related and management issues while ensuring technical priorities are met.

Day to Day

  • Lead the Workplace/Accumulation Service team to ensure high quality delivery of tasks, aligning with Lab agile methodologies.
  • Acting as Lead SME for any incident resolution relating to underlying platforms or online service
  • Ensure there is a continuous focus and improvement on service stability and observability. Lead trend analysis to improve service and own all lifecycle management activities on tools including ServiceNow.
  • Influence the technical direction of the lab and wider platform by mentoring your teams and ensuring the delivery of robust, scalable, secure and innovative solutions.
  • Collaborate closely with product owners, architects, engineers and developers, to prioritise and deliver the roadmap.
  • Foster an engineering culture of experimentation, learning and continuous innovation whilst shaping and contributing to the overall technical strategy
  • Play an active part in the Engineering Leadership team, supporting others & directly reporting into the Lab Engineering Lead

What You'll Need

  • Technology Expertise - Provide deep technical insights and lead the resolution of complex service-related issues within our source business systems and our web technologies. Proven ability to implement system changes and ensure operational stability across multiple platforms and business units.
  • Operational - Take full ownership of system availability, performance, and currency, accepting 24/7 accountability. Proven experience improving Run operations for high-availability systems, including automation, monitoring, and observability. Demonstrable experience of incident resolution, war room support and root cause identification. Troubleshoot, debug, and resolve technical issues and challenges. Explains and prioritises problems and their possible solutions with colleagues and other partners.
  • Leadership - Setting engineering standards and ensuring solutions align with business goals and architecture. Define, communicate, and implement the engineering service strategy and standards across the platform by focusing on methods and collaborating to embed them throughout end-to-end engineering activities. Ability to support diverse engineering change in an agile environment, with strong collaboration and communication skills. Responsible for line management, coaching, mentoring, and promoting standards across Product & Engineering.
  • Governance - Manage third party relationships and support regular Governance meetings, with a focus on service performance, security and risks.

And Any Experience Of These Would Be Really Useful

  • Software Engineering - Possess a deep understanding of the software lifecycle, ensuring high standards in design, development, testing, and deployment. Our stack is predominantly JavaScript, Node, React and GCP.
  • Cloud Platform - Familiarity with the development of resilient systems on cloud platforms such as GCP, Azure or AWS.
